SOCAR Turkey starts cooperation with Siemens

SOCAR Turkey, a subsidiary of the State Oil Company of Azerbaijan (SOCAR) in Turkey, and Siemens Turkey have signed an agreement on the supply of basic energy distribution infrastructure.

Under the agreement, in the next five years, Siemens Turkey will undertake to supply STAR Oil Refinery, SOCAR Depolama, and Petkim, which operate under SOCAR Turkey's Oil Refining and Petrochemical Cooperation, with installations and upgrade all energy distribution infrastructure of petrochemical holding with SCADA systems, Report informs.

The signing ceremony took place at SOCAR Turkey's office in Aliaga settlement in Izmir.

Anar Mammadov, President of SOCAR Turkey's Oil Refining and Petrochemical Business Department and CEO of Petkim, said the cooperation would make digital transformation efforts involving all groups of companies more effective. He said that with the infrastructure support provided by Siemens in digitalization, they will make efforts to strengthen their activities.

Mammadov underlined that the digital transformation will continue to be one of the most important sectors in the future with new investments and projects.

SOCAR Turkey was established in late 2006. The company was established in Turkey to implement projects in the oil refining and petro-chemistry sector, to trade in natural gas. SOCAR Turkey owns a stake (51%) in Turkey's Petkim Petrokimya Holding.

So far, SOCAR has invested $16.5 billion in Turkey and is negotiating new investments. The company plans to expand its activities in Turkey, primarily in the petrochemical and gas sectors.
